Fullstack developer .NET & React - Senior

  • Full-time

Company Description

We are looking for a detail-oriented and product-minded Senior Fullstack Developer to join a digital platform project developed for a leading company in the elevator and vertical transportation consulting space. The company offers expert services across design, modernisation, maintenance, and safety for vertical transport systems in sectors such as commercial real estate, healthcare, hospitality, and transportation hubs.

In this role, you will be responsible for delivering high-quality, scalable, and maintainable front-end features using React. You will work closely with designers, product managers, and back-end developers to bring intuitive, performant, and business-aligned interfaces to life. A strong understanding of business needs and a proactive, ownership-driven attitude are essential. Experience with backend technologies, particularly .NET, is a plus and will help in grasping the full project landscape.

Job Description

  • Develop and maintain modern, responsive web interfaces using React, TypeScript, and related technologies.
  • Translate product requirements and business needs into clean, maintainable code.
  • Collaborate with product managers to deliver intuitive and user-centric features.
  • Ensure application performance, quality, and responsiveness across browsers and devices.
  • Participate in technical planning, code reviews, and architecture discussions.
  • Work closely with backend engineers to define and integrate APIs, ideally with some understanding of .NET services.
  • Contribute to the continuous improvement of development practices, tooling, and team culture.
  • Identify and resolve performance bottlenecks and bugs quickly and efficiently.

Qualifications

  • 5+ years of hands-on experience with React and JavaScript/TypeScript in a production environment.
  • Experience working in full-stack environments with .NET/C# back-end systems.
  • Strong attention to detail and a product-oriented mindset with the ability to understand the “why” behind business requirements.
  • Solid knowledge of front-end architecture, state management, and component-based development.
  • Experience with REST APIs and understanding of client-server communication patterns.
  • Familiarity with CI/CD workflows and Agile methodologies.
  • Ability to work independently and as part of a collaborative, cross-functional team.
  • Fluent in English (written and spoken).

Nice-to-Have Skills:

  • Understanding of authentication, authorisation, and secure front-end development.
  • Experience with automated testing frameworks (e.g., Jest, Testing Library, Cypress).
  • Previous experience working on product teams or customer-facing digital platforms.
  • Familiarity with UX best practices and design systems.

Additional Information

If this role caught your attention, we're looking forward to discussing more about it!